Sen. Mark Udall, a Colorado Democrat, has placed a hold on a community bank bill that would increase the 500-shareholder threshold that requires a small bank to register with the SEC. He is conditioning his support on the advancement of a separate bill that would raise the cap on credit union member business lending.
